Ravintovarastoja
Ravintovarastoja refers to the stored nutrients within an organism that can be utilized to meet its metabolic demands. These stores are essential for survival, particularly during periods of food scarcity or increased energy requirements. The primary forms of energy storage in animals are fats, carbohydrates, and proteins, though they are mobilized differently.
